About the role:

We are seeking motivated and compassionate Psychology Graduates to join leading special schools in Surrey providing support to students with Special Educational Needs (SEN). You will be assisting students with Autism, Social, Emotional, and Mental Health (SEMH) needs, and other learning difficulties.

As a Learning Support Assistant, you will play a key role in shaping students' educational experiences and supporting their personal development both inside and outside the classroom.

Key responsibilities:

  • 1:1 and Small Group Support:
    Assist students across various age groups, from Early Years through to Post-16
  • Promoting Independence:
    Encourage students to develop crucial skills in a supportive, inclusive environment
  • Tailored Learning:
    Collaborate with teaching staff to provide personalised support that empowers students to reach their full potential
